$90 Entry Fee includes:
Hack Delivery ~ the focus of this clinic will be on sound delivery mechanics. Proper set up in the hack grip, timing, leg drive and release technique will be illustrated and developed. Sport Etiquette and safety will also be discussed with a focus on the new procedures in this pandemic world. Basic sweeping techniques including footwork for open style sweeping will be introduced, proper broom positioning & weight judgment will be established. Also, basic rules of the game, scoring and elementary Strategy & Tactics.
Stick Delivery ~ the main focus of this session will be delivery mechanics and Safety procedures. Set up and line delivery will be the main focus. Some work on sweeping, and basic strategy & tactics.

Curling is a unique sport that requires both skill and strategy. It is often referred to as chess on ice. It is a lifelong sport that can be learned at any age. Whether playing in a fun league or a competitive ladder the emphasis is always on sportsmanship and fair play. Being a social sport by nature, it is not uncommon for teams to socialize off the ice where lasting friendships are often made.
